The Mills County Goat & Sheep Auction
There’s no better introduction to Goldthwaite than a Thursday morning at the livestock barn. The Clifton family runs one of the largest goat and sheep auctions in the country right here in Mills County, and Chet got a front-row seat. Fast-talking auctioneers, buyers from across the state, and the kind of no-nonsense commerce that has defined this community for generations. Goldthwaite is the Meat Goat Capital of America, and this is the proof.
Mary’s Tacos & Burgers: A 25-Year Goldthwaite Institution
When you’re looking for the best food in Goldthwaite, TX, start at Mary’s. This family-run spot has been feeding the community for 25 years with hand-rolled tortillas, freshly fried shells, and burgers grilled by Mary’s own sons. Chet didn’t have to choose between tacos and burgers. Neither do you. Order both, and you’ll understand immediately why this place has been a local cornerstone for a quarter century.
Texas Botanical Gardens & Native American Interpretive Center
Goldthwaite’s story doesn’t start in 1893. It starts thousands of years before that. The Texas Botanical Gardens and Native American Interpretive Center brings that history to life through ancient bedrock mortars, native plants used for food and medicine, and flavors tied directly to the land — like pecan milk and prickly pear jelly. Chet explored it all, and it’s one of the most thought-provoking stops in Central Texas.

Mills County General Store: Still Showing Up After 100 Years
The Mills County General Store isn’t a museum piece — it’s a working part of this town. Bike repairs, saddle fixes, everyday essentials, and the kind of unhurried conversation that’s hard to find anywhere else. Chet spent time with the folks keeping this century-old spot alive and heard stories that connect generations. That’s Goldthwaite in a nutshell.
Mills County Historical Museum: Where Goldthwaite’s Story Lives
If you want to understand Goldthwaite, start at the Mills County Historical Museum. Housed in the 1893 Palmer Building on Fisher Street, the museum walks visitors through local life room by room: a post office, drugstore, schoolhouse, dentist’s office, kitchen, and barn workshop, all filled with real artifacts donated by real Mills County families. Before it was a museum, the building housed a Piggly Wiggly. Before that, rumor has it, a saloon. Nearly every exhibit has been built by volunteers who showed up because this community’s history matters. Walk through it slowly.
Southside Tavern: Small-Town Innovation on a Plate
The Hammond family took an old feed store and turned it into one of the most creative dining spots in the Texas Hill Country. Bacon-wrapped meatloaf medallions. Texas-sized steaks. A menu that feels both rooted in this place and genuinely inventive. Southside Tavern is the kind of restaurant that makes a town proud, and the kind of discovery that makes a Daytripper episode unforgettable.
